Lidl has confirmed on Wednesday that they are to open 19 stores across England over the next two months and will create around 640 jobs.

The German discount supermarket is now the sixth largest grocery chain in the UK and revealed plans to invest around £40 million to refurbish more than 70 of their current stores.

Lidl will install larger freezers and new tills and by the end of February they want to have a further 40 stores.

Richard Taylor, chief real estate officer at Lidl GB, said, “We’re starting the new year as we mean to go on, with a major investment that reinforces our commitment to delivering the best experience for customers and creating a positive impact for the communities we serve.

“With this push, we’re set on winning more shoppers across the nation and claiming an even bigger share of the market.”
